Columbia Upper Elementary School
vs.
George Long Elementary School

A side-by-side view of publicly reported data for these two schools.

Columbia Upper Elementary School
George Long Elementary School
  • George Long Elementary School reported a higher students per counselor than Columbia Upper Elementary School (589:1 vs. 425:1).
  • George Long Elementary School reported a higher chronically absent students than Columbia Upper Elementary School (99 vs. 63).
  • Columbia Upper Elementary School reported a higher out-of-school suspensions than George Long Elementary School (16 vs. 1).
  • Source Data Limit: 5 metrics are directly comparable between the two schools.
